Output 2a23a62cf31b79a8d7704e16f4dfc15284c76777afa11426e86d0892cd986835:1

value
2512100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721edd921bccef06b20422fe039f6aa8a9453c78 OP_EQUAL
address
3C6Rvz89ovbbGJpPHY6AfoQKwSH745b5LP
transaction
2a23a62cf31b79a8d7704e16f4dfc15284c76777afa11426e86d0892cd986835